ARDMORE, Okla. -- Ardmore and Plainview teachers received a special reward on Monday. More than 50 educators were surprised to find that they were not only receiving recognition, but money as well.
It was part of the Ardmore Cornerstone Initiative from the Chamber Of Commerce.
"Teachers fill out an application, and a majority of the application has to do with student academic progress. They take their students, figure out where they're low and then they bring them along to higher levels," Philip Black, director of Cornerstone, said.
State Board of Education members chose recipients based on outstanding accomplishments in the classroom.
